How Does an IP Phone System Function?

The “IP” in IP phone system references a Voice over IP, which means having telephone calls re-routed via an internet connection or a local network, also known as LAN. This can be an excellent choice of services for a number of reasons. First and foremost, an IP phone system removed the necessity of employing the telephone network of your current service provider when you make calls, thereby reducing your overall phone costs. It also grants a variety of significant technical advantages.

Individuals or companies set up with an IP Telephone System can easily plug any IP phone into the most convenient LAN port. The IP phone will automatically connect through the phone system in place. The number of the IP phone will not change, and no matter where it is plugged in, it will function as programmed. This ease of use is made possible by an SIP protocol. ISPs, VoIP phones and phone systems across the globe use this protocol as a default. It renders costly landline phones unnecessary and facilitates affordable and reliable communication channels. The majority of IP phone systems run on standard computer hardware, which is of course more advanced than that of your typical telephone. This hardware also scales better to the specific size of your operation, and is in no way limited to the availability of physical telephone ports. As your company grows, your IP phone system can grow with you.

There are many advantages to choosing an IP phone system to a traditional one. Here are just a few of the benefits you’ll receive:

-No more long distance fees and additional costs. All of your calls go through the company’s intranet, and are thus treated equally

-The latest phone services and technologies, including advanced mobility options and unified communications

-Enhanced customization for users and practically limitless geographical functionality

-Significantly lower telephone costs, equipment, upkeep and maintenance charges
